語源

From 中期英語 forholden (to withhold; to keep (a corpse) unburied) [and other forms], from 古期英語 forhealdan (to keep or hold back (something), withhold; to hold away; to disregard, neglect; to hold wrongly, not to keep in good condition), from for- (prefix meaningaway from; wrongly) + healdan (to grasp, hold fast; to possess) (from Proto-West Germanic *haldan (to hold; to keep), from Proto-Germanic *haldaną (to hold; to keep); further etymology uncertain, possibly from Proto-Indo-European *ḱel- (to cover; to conceal, hide)). The English word is analysable as for- +‎ hold, and is cognate with Danish forholde (to relate), Dutch verhouden (to relate), Low German vorholden (to detain), German verhalten (to control, restrain), Norwegian forholde (to deal).

動詞

forhold (third-person singular simple present forholds, present participle forholding, simple past forheld, past participle forheld or forholden)

  1. (transitive, archaic, rare) To detain, hold back, or hold up (someone or something); also, to retain or withhold (something).
